It can be done via: -device e1000,netdev=net0 -netdev user,id=net0,hostfwd=tcp::5555-:22 The first line creates a virtual e1000 network device, while the second line created one user typed backend, forwarding local port 5555 to guest port 22. One option is to forward connections to ports 80 / 443 on the server to a VM running a reverse proxy (eg, NGINX or HAProxy), which can then proxy those connections to other VMs. *These libvirt iptables rules in the last grey section above were obtained by running iptables-save and confirming port forwarding was working, then sending SIGHUP to libvirt, confirming port forwarding was broken, then running iptables-save again and running a diff on the two outputs to find which new iptables rules were added by libvirt.
